I still wish premium shells were different, instead of just "here's more pen with minor trade offs."
Like if APCR kept its higher pen, but did less damage and had a chance of penning a tank and zipping through the other side if whatever it shot at had low armor. Or HEAT would have a higher chance of module damage/crew injury at the expense of damage. HE could damage external modules or stun the crew reducing their effectiveness.
Just seems like there is so much more they could do with ammo types to make things interesting.

From status report:
-It's possible the platoon missions from individual missions will be removed ("there are multiple variants"), developers do have statistics on how many people are "stuck" on platoon mission;
- HT15 individual mission will be simplified for StuG IV and T28HTC;

I'm a fan of both of these. I don't like that platoon missions are part of the individual mission line, if they were bonus objectives I'd be perfectly fine with that. Plus the LT and SPG missions are pretty dumb and rely on a fair amount of luck that not only will your spotting damage count, but the SPG diceroll will come up.
